2004 Chevy Trailblazer Low Beam Headlights
Re: 2004 Chevy Trailblazer Low Beam Headlights
We are having the same problem ...no low beams even after replacing the bulbs. Tried switching the HDM... did as described on your site and now the car has no power. switched back ...still no power. Help! I need my car..now it won't even start! Susan
Re: 2004 Chevy Trailblazer Low Beam Headlights
Ok, switching around the HDM relay should NOT cause any problems. You must have done something wrong, popped other fuses, or fried a module somewhere. But, back to the headlamp problem, you should remove the bulbs and check the connectors (sockets) for any burned terminals. That is a common issue as well. If it's not that, you're in the same boat as the other guy here and either have a wiring issue, bad headlamp switch, etc. Any of that would take some involved checking and diagnosis.
